Odoo: Waarom een alles-in-één applicatie vaak beter is dan werken met meerdere microservices

In de wereld van softwareontwikkeling zijn er verschillende manieren om software te bouwen en te onderhouden. Een populaire trend in de afgelopen jaren is het gebruik van microservices-architecturen, waarbij software wordt gebroken in kleine, onafhankelijke diensten die samenwerken om een grotere applicatie te vormen. Hoewel dit aanpak enkele voordelen heeft, kan het werken met meerdere microservices ook complexiteit met zich meebrengen en kan het in sommige gevallen inefficiënt zijn.

Een alternatief voor het werken met meerdere microservices is het gebruik van een alles-in-één applicatie zoals Odoo. Odoo is een open-source ERP-systeem dat verschillende bedrijfsprocessen integreert, waaronder CRM, verkoop, aankoop, inventaris, boekhouding, projectbeheer en meer. In dit artikel bespreken we waarom een alles-in-één applicatie als Odoo een betere keuze kan zijn dan het werken met meerdere microservices.

Eenvoudiger implementatie en onderhoud

Wanneer u werkt met meerdere microservices, moet u elke dienst afzonderlijk ontwikkelen, implementeren, beheren en onderhouden. Dit kan een complex en tijdrovend proces zijn, vooral als uw applicatie uit veel diensten bestaat. Met Odoo hoeft u slechts één applicatie te installeren en te onderhouden. Dit maakt de implementatie en het onderhoud van uw applicatie veel eenvoudiger en minder tijdrovend.

Geïntegreerde functionaliteit

Wanneer u werkt met meerdere microservices, moet u verschillende diensten integreren om de gewenste functionaliteit te bereiken. Dit kan een complex proces zijn en kan leiden tot inconsistenties en fouten in uw applicatie. Met Odoo hebt u toegang tot geïntegreerde functionaliteit voor verschillende bedrijfsprocessen, waardoor u de noodzaak om verschillende diensten te integreren elimineert. Dit maakt het eenvoudiger om uw applicatie te ontwikkelen en te onderhouden en vermindert de kans op inconsistenties en fouten.

Lagere kosten

Het werken met meerdere microservices kan duur zijn, vooral als u verschillende diensten moet integreren om de gewenste functionaliteit te bereiken. Met Odoo hebt u toegang tot een alles-in-één applicatie die de meeste van uw bedrijfsprocessen integreert. Dit kan de kosten van uw applicatieontwikkeling en -onderhoud aanzienlijk verminderen, omdat u niet hoeft te investeren in de ontwikkeling en integratie van verschillende diensten.

Betere prestaties

Wanneer u werkt met meerdere microservices, moet u elk verzoek door meerdere diensten sturen om de gewenste functionaliteit te bereiken. Dit kan leiden tot vertragingen en prestatieproblemen in uw applicatie. Met Odoo hebt u toegang tot

geïntegreerde functionaliteit, waardoor u verzoeken efficiënter kunt afhandelen en betere prestaties kunt bereiken. Omdat alle functionaliteiten in één applicatie zijn geïntegreerd, kan Odoo taken sneller verwerken en biedt het een betere gebruikerservaring.

Verbeterde gebruikerservaring

Een alles-in-één applicatie zoals Odoo biedt een uniforme gebruikersinterface en gebruikerservaring voor alle bedrijfsprocessen. Gebruikers hoeven niet te schakelen tussen verschillende applicaties en interfaces om verschillende taken uit te voeren. Dit vereenvoudigt de leercurve en verbetert de productiviteit van gebruikers. Bovendien kan een alles-in-één applicatie zoals Odoo beter inspelen op de specifieke behoeften van gebruikers, omdat alle functionaliteiten worden ontwikkeld als onderdeel van hetzelfde systeem.

Eenvoudig gegevensbeheer

Wanneer u werkt met meerdere microservices, moet u omgaan met gegevenssynchronisatie en consistentie tussen de verschillende diensten. Dit kan uitdagend zijn en kan leiden tot problemen zoals inconsistenties en dubbele gegevens. Met Odoo, als alles-in-één applicatie, worden gegevens centraal beheerd en is er geen noodzaak voor complexe gegevenssynchronisatie. Dit vermindert het risico op inconsistenties en zorgt voor een beter gegevensbeheer.

Flexibiliteit en schaalbaarheid

Hoewel het werken met meerdere microservices flexibiliteit kan bieden, kan het ook leiden tot een complexe architectuur die moeilijk te schalen en aan te passen is. Met Odoo kunt u echter profiteren van de flexibiliteit en schaalbaarheid van een alles-in-één applicatie. U kunt functionaliteiten toevoegen of verwijderen op basis van uw behoeften, en u kunt het systeem eenvoudig schalen naarmate uw bedrijf groeit.

Kortom, hoewel werken met meerdere microservices voordelen kan bieden, zoals modulariteit en flexibiliteit, kan het ook complexiteit met zich meebrengen en inefficiënt zijn. Een alles-in-één applicatie zoals Odoo kan een betere keuze zijn als het gaat om eenvoudige implementatie, geïntegreerde functionaliteit, lagere kosten, betere prestaties, verbeterde gebruikerservaring, eenvoudig gegevensbeheer en flexibiliteit. Het is belangrijk om uw specifieke behoeften en vereisten te evalueren voordat u een keuze maakt tussen werken met meerdere microservices of een alles-in-één applicatie zoals Odoo.